Jolyon Palmer "feeling good" about Brazil

Jolyon Palmer is confident that he can perform well in Brazil this weekend.

The Brit, who is fighting for his future with Renault, has enjoyed an upturn in for in the second half of the year, including his long-awaited first points in Malaysia last month.

Now 2014 GP2 champion Palmer is hoping to carry on that good form at the penultimate round of the season.

"I'm feeling good for Brazil as it should just carry on the good momentum that we've had in the second half the year," said Palmer.

"It was a shame not to qualify last time out as we could have shown even better improvement," he said. "One of my best grid spots was in prospect, but we made up for it in the race. The race pace has been good for a long time now, qualifying pace has been good too."

"We had some decent battles with the McLarens in Mexico, so I think we can be pretty confident going into Brazil," he added.
